The Expanse: A Telltale Series Launches with Episode 1 – Archer’s Paradox

Today is a huge day for Telltale with the launch of The Expanse: A Telltale Series. The episodic game is now live for P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, and PC via Epic Games Store. Today’s launch brings Episode 1 – Archer’s Paradox to players with more chapters to be released over time.

Fans interested in purchasing a copy of the game can do so in any one of two versions with the Deluxe Edition offering a bonus chapter called Archangel. The bonus episode can also be purchased as a standalone product. The Standard Edition is $39.99. The Deluxe edition is $44.99.

The Expanse: A Telltale Series is set prior to the events of Alcon Television Group’s award-winning television series which streams on Amazon Prime Video and iTunes. Players take on the role of Camina Drummer – played by actress Cara Gee in both the game and TV series, the XO of a scavenger crew on the hunt for a mysterious treasure on the edges of The Belt. As Drummer, players must deal with a mix of powerful personalities, square off against a bloody mutiny, explore locations beyond The Belt and, most of all, make tough decisions that will decide the fate of The Artemis crew. 

Developers have created four additional chapters that will continue the overarching storyline. These will be released every two weeks so that players won’t have to wait too long between episodes.

“After four long years, we are all so excited to be here launching our first new game and we cannot wait for fans to play it. We felt great responsibility to honor the legacy – through great storytelling with compelling characters, and difficult but meaningful choices,” said Jamie Ottilie, Telltale CEO. “We’ve also worked to raise expectations from a Telltale game with more action, bigger environments and new mechanics like Zero-G.”
